Throughout markets, general count on news (40%) and depend on in the resources people utilize themselves (46%) are down by an even more 2 percent points this year


Undoubtedly, through the rear-view mirror, the COVID-19 depend on bump is plainly visible in the complying with graph, though the instructions of travel later on has actually been blended. In many cases (e.g. Finland), the count on boost has been preserved, while in others the upturn looks even more like a spot in a tale of continued long-lasting decrease.


A few of the greatest reported degrees of media objection are located in nations with highest levels of question, such as Greece, the Philippines, the USA, France, and the United Kingdom. The this article most affordable degrees of media objection are often in those with higher levels of count on, such as Finland, Norway, Denmark, and Japan.

This year we asked respondents about their choices for message, sound and video clip when taking in news online. On average, we locate that the bulk still like to read the news (57%), instead than watch (30%) or pay attention to it (13%), but more youthful individuals (under-35s) are extra most likely to listen (17%) than older teams.


Behind the standards we find significant and surprising nation distinctions. In markets with a strong analysis custom, such as Finland and the United Kingdom, around 8 in 10 still choose to read on-line information, however in India and Thailand, around four in 10 (40%) claim they like to view information online, and in the Philippines that percentage mores than fifty percent (52%).


In lots of Oriental nations, populations have a tendency to be younger, mobile information often tend to be fairly economical, and video information is commonly available using platforms such as YouTube and TikTok. In Thailand, for instance, higher opportunities for liberty of expression online have brought about the development of a spate of independent TV-style online shows that are extensively taken in on cellphones.
